So, I've still been looking and have found a possible alternative that is far more cost effective and actually is better in many ways. It is available on Amazon.co.uk and is designed originally to be used by cafe's etc... to display pastries etc... It has 3 shelves, plus the bottom of the cabinet so effectively 4 shelves. Each of these is big enough to house 3 Mini-4wd side by side facing forwards, and quite possibly 4 per shelf if placed side on and 2 deep. Of course in this configuration you may need something to lift up the two rear ones a bit so they are viewed better, but I've not decided yet. It also has a door with a handle which is held closed by miniature magnets. This cabinet cost me around the same as the one from Ali.
I've also enhanced it by adding some lighting, this is in the form of miniature LED lights which are contained in little chromed steel tubes. They are twisted to turn them on and off. To secure them in place I've glued some small Neodymium magnets to the top of the shelves (and top plate) and the magnets hold the lights in place below the shelf. This allows you to get them out easily to turn them on and off or if needed replace the batteries. This works very well and illuminates my beloved cars very nicely as you can see in the pictures attached.
